Being a general manager of a football team is a tough job that requires making difficult decisions and taking calculated risks. The weight of the team's success or failure rests on their shoulders, and it's not always easy to predict the outcome of a particular move.

A big trade can be a crucial turning point for a team in the midst of a rebuild. It can bring in much-needed talent and shake things up, but it's not a guarantee of success. In fact, there are times when a big trade can actually hinder a team's chances of success in the long run.

One of the main reasons why winning a big trade doesn't always lead to rebuild success is because it can create unrealistic expectations. Fans and the media often get caught up in the excitement of a big trade and start to expect immediate results. However, rebuilding a team is a process that takes time, patience, and perseverance.

Another reason why big trades can be tricky is because they often involve giving up valuable assets in the process. A team may give up a high draft pick or a talented young player in exchange for a veteran player who may only be with the team for a few years. If that veteran player doesn't live up to expectations, the team may be left with a big hole to fill.

Furthermore, big trades can also disrupt team chemistry and create tension in the locker room. When a new player comes in, it can be difficult for them to adjust to the team's culture and system. This can lead to conflicts and create an uncomfortable environment for the other players.

Lastly, big trades are not always indicative of a team's commitment to rebuilding. Sometimes, a team may make a big trade just to appease the fans or to create a buzz around the team. However, if the team is not committed to rebuilding from the ground up, it can be difficult to sustain success over the long term.

In conclusion, being a general manager of a football team is a challenging job that requires making tough decisions and taking calculated risks. While winning a big trade can be exciting, it's not always a guarantee of success. Teams must be patient, persistent, and committed to rebuilding if they want to achieve long-term success.
